Victory RS Small Cap Growth Fund - Class Y (RSYEX) Research
This fund primarily dedicates at least 80% of its total assets to enterprises classified as small-capitalization. The investment advisor currently defines a small-cap company by its market value at the time of acquisition, considering it such if its capitalization is either below $3 billion or up to 120% of the largest company within the Russell 2000® Index, whichever criterion yields the higher threshold. While the portfolio generally concentrates its investments in the equity securities of U.S. businesses, it retains the flexibility to commit any portion of its holdings to international stocks, including various depositary receipts like ADRs and GDRs.
